The future of the global DIN rail I/O module market looks promising with opportunities in the industrial automation, smart manufacturing & industrial IoT, smart building, power system, petrochemical, and rail transit markets. The global DIN rail I/O module market is expected to reach an estimated $1.9 billion by 2035 with a CAGR of 3.8% from 2026 to 2035. The major drivers for this market are the increasing adoption of industrial automation systems, the rising demand for smart manufacturing solutions, and the growing use of connected factory devices.
- Lucintel forecasts that, within the type category, digital output module is expected to witness the highest growth over the forecast period.
- Within the application category, industrial automation is expected to witness the highest growth.
- In terms of region, APAC is expected to witness the highest growth over the forecast period.
Emerging Trends in the DIN Rail I/O Module Market
The DIN rail I/O module market is experiencing rapid growth driven by advancements in industrial automation, increasing demand for smart manufacturing solutions, and the integration of IoT technologies. As industries seek more efficient, scalable, and flexible automation systems, the market is evolving with innovative products and strategic collaborations. These developments are transforming traditional automation landscapes, enabling enhanced productivity, real-time data collection, and improved system interoperability. Understanding the key emerging trends is essential for stakeholders to capitalize on new opportunities and stay competitive in this dynamic environment.
- Increasing Adoption of IoT and Industry 4.0: The integration of IoT and Industry 4.0 principles is revolutionizing the DIN Rail I/O Module market. These modules now support real-time data exchange, remote monitoring, and predictive maintenance, leading to smarter factories. This trend enhances operational efficiency, reduces downtime, and enables seamless communication between devices. As industries adopt connected systems, demand for compatible I/O modules that facilitate data integration and automation is surging, driving market growth and innovation.
- Growing Focus on Modular and Scalable Solutions: Modern automation systems require flexibility to adapt to changing production needs. Modular DIN Rail I/O modules allow easy expansion and customization, reducing initial investment costs. This trend supports scalable automation architectures, enabling manufacturers to add or upgrade modules without overhauling entire systems. The emphasis on modularity improves system reliability, simplifies maintenance, and accelerates deployment, making it a key driver for market expansion across diverse industrial sectors.
- Rising Demand for Wireless and Remote I/O Modules: Wireless I/O modules are gaining popularity due to their ease of installation and ability to operate in hard-to-reach or hazardous environments. They eliminate the need for extensive wiring, reducing installation time and costs. This trend enhances flexibility in system design and maintenance, especially in complex or large-scale setups. As wireless communication standards improve, the market for remote I/O modules is expected to grow significantly, supporting more dynamic and adaptable automation solutions.
- Emphasis on Energy Efficiency and Sustainability: Environmental concerns and energy regulations are prompting manufacturers to develop energy-efficient DIN Rail I/O modules. These modules incorporate low-power components and intelligent power management features to minimize energy consumption. This trend aligns with the global push towards sustainable manufacturing practices, reducing operational costs and carbon footprint. The focus on energy efficiency is influencing product design and driving innovation in the market, making sustainable automation solutions more accessible and attractive.
- Increasing Integration of Advanced Diagnostics and Safety Features: Modern DIN Rail I/O modules are equipped with advanced diagnostic tools and safety features to ensure reliable operation and personnel safety. Real-time fault detection, predictive diagnostics, and fail-safe mechanisms are becoming standard. This trend enhances system reliability, reduces downtime, and ensures compliance with safety standards. The integration of these features is critical for critical infrastructure and high-stakes manufacturing environments, fostering trust and expanding market opportunities for sophisticated automation solutions.

DIN Rail I/O Module Market Driver and Challenges
The DIN rail I/O module market is influenced by a variety of technological, economic, and regulatory factors that shape its growth and development. Advances in automation and industrial control systems drive demand for reliable and scalable I/O modules. Economic factors such as increasing industrialization and infrastructure development contribute to market expansion. Regulatory standards for safety, interoperability, and environmental compliance also impact product design and adoption. Additionally, technological innovations like IoT integration and smart manufacturing are pushing the market toward more intelligent and connected solutions. Navigating these drivers and overcoming associated challenges is essential for stakeholders aiming to capitalize on emerging opportunities within this dynamic industry.
The factors responsible for driving the DIN rail I/O module market include:-
- Technological Innovation: The rapid evolution of automation technology, including IoT and Industry 4.0, necessitates advanced I/O modules capable of supporting complex, interconnected systems. These innovations enable real-time data collection, remote monitoring, and predictive maintenance, which improve operational efficiency and reduce downtime. As industries adopt smarter manufacturing processes, the demand for sophisticated DIN rail I/O modules increases, fostering market growth. Companies investing in R&D to develop more versatile, scalable, and energy-efficient modules are further propelling this trend, ensuring the market remains competitive and aligned with technological advancements.
- Industrial Automation Growth: The expanding adoption of automation across manufacturing, energy, and transportation sectors significantly boosts demand for DIN rail I/O modules. Automation enhances productivity, safety, and quality control, prompting industries to upgrade existing control systems with more reliable and flexible I/O solutions. The rise of Industry 4.0 initiatives emphasizes interconnected, intelligent systems, which rely heavily on high-performance I/O modules. As industries seek to optimize operations and meet increasing production demands, the market for DIN rail I/O modules continues to expand, driven by the need for seamless integration and robust performance.
- Regulatory and Safety Standards: Stringent regulatory requirements related to safety, environmental impact, and interoperability influence the design and deployment of DIN rail I/O modules. Compliance with standards such as IEC, UL, and RoHS ensures product safety and environmental sustainability, which is critical for market acceptance. Manufacturers are compelled to innovate and adapt their products to meet evolving regulations, often leading to higher quality and more reliable modules. These standards also promote interoperability among different systems and devices, facilitating broader adoption and integration within diverse industrial environments.
- Economic Development and Infrastructure Projects: Growing investments in infrastructure, energy, and manufacturing sectors worldwide drive demand for automation components, including DIN rail I/O modules. Developing economies are particularly focused on modernizing their industrial base, which involves upgrading control systems with advanced I/O solutions. Large-scale projects in transportation, power generation, and water management create substantial opportunities for market players. As economic growth accelerates, the need for efficient, scalable, and cost-effective I/O modules becomes more pronounced, fueling market expansion.
- Technological Convergence and Customization: The increasing need for tailored automation solutions encourages the development of customizable DIN rail I/O modules. Industries demand modules that can be easily integrated into existing systems and adapted to specific operational requirements. The convergence of technologies such as wireless communication, cloud computing, and edge computing further enhances the capabilities of I/O modules. Manufacturers focusing on modular, flexible, and user-friendly products are better positioned to meet diverse customer needs, thereby driving market growth through innovation and differentiation.
- High Cost of Advanced Modules: While technologically advanced DIN rail I/O modules offer enhanced features, their higher manufacturing and development costs can limit adoption, especially among small and medium-sized enterprises. The price sensitivity in certain industries constrains market penetration, requiring manufacturers to balance innovation with affordability. Additionally, ongoing maintenance and upgrade costs can further impact the total cost of ownership, making cost-effective solutions a critical factor for widespread adoption.
- Rapid Technological Obsolescence: The fast pace of technological change in automation and control systems can render existing I/O modules obsolete quickly. Companies face the challenge of continuously updating their product offerings to stay competitive, which involves significant R&D investments. This rapid obsolescence also leads to increased inventory management complexities and potential waste, impacting profitability and supply chain stability.
- Regulatory Compliance and Certification Delays: Navigating complex regulatory landscapes and obtaining necessary certifications can be time-consuming and costly. Delays in compliance processes may hinder product launches and market entry, affecting revenue streams. Moreover, evolving standards require ongoing product modifications, increasing development cycles and operational costs. Ensuring compliance while maintaining competitive pricing remains a persistent challenge for manufacturers in this market.

The DIN rail I/O module market has experienced significant growth driven by increasing automation across industries, technological advancements, and the rising demand for efficient control systems. As industries modernize, the adoption of DIN rail modules for industrial automation, process control, and building management systems has accelerated. Countries are focusing on integrating smart technologies, enhancing connectivity, and improving energy efficiency. The markets evolution reflects a shift towards more reliable, scalable, and cost-effective solutions, with regional players innovating to meet diverse industrial needs. This dynamic landscape is shaping the future of industrial automation worldwide, with each country contributing unique developments based on its industrial priorities.
- United States: The US market has seen rapid adoption of smart automation solutions, with significant investments in Industry 4.0 initiatives, leading to increased demand for advanced DIN rail I/O modules. Key players are focusing on integrating IoT capabilities and enhancing cybersecurity features to meet industrial standards. The growth is driven by manufacturing, automotive, and energy sectors, emphasizing automation and data analytics. Regulatory support for sustainable practices and digital transformation initiatives further boosts market expansion.
- China: China remains a dominant force in the DIN rail I/O module market, driven by rapid industrialization and government policies promoting smart manufacturing. Local manufacturers are innovating with cost-effective, high-performance modules tailored for large-scale infrastructure projects. The focus is on integrating AI and IoT for predictive maintenance and operational efficiency. The market benefits from extensive infrastructure development and a growing emphasis on automation in sectors like electronics, textiles, and automotive.
- Germany: Germanys market is characterized by high-quality, precision-engineered DIN rail I/O modules, catering to the automotive, machinery, and chemical industries. The emphasis on Industry 4.0 and Industrie 4.0 standards has led to increased adoption of modular, interoperable solutions. German companies are investing in R&D to develop energy-efficient and environmentally friendly modules. The focus on sustainability and automation standards aligns with the country's push for green manufacturing practices.
- India: The Indian market is witnessing rapid growth due to expanding manufacturing, infrastructure projects, and government initiatives like Make in India. Local and international companies are introducing affordable, reliable DIN rail I/O modules to cater to small and medium enterprises. The adoption of automation in sectors such as textiles, pharmaceuticals, and food processing is accelerating. There is also a rising trend towards integrating IoT for smarter factory management and operational efficiency.
- Japan: Japans market emphasizes high reliability, durability, and advanced features in DIN rail I/O modules, driven by the automotive, electronics, and robotics sectors. The focus is on miniaturization, energy efficiency, and seamless integration with existing automation systems. Japanese firms are investing in innovative technologies like AI and machine learning to enhance predictive maintenance and system optimization. The market benefits from a strong emphasis on quality standards and technological innovation.
